简介:随着人工智能技术的广泛应用,MLOps作为人工智能工程化的关键一环,逐渐受到业界的重视。本文将从MLOps的基本概念出发,探讨MLOps的实践方法、挑战及未来发展。
人工智能(AI)技术的发展正在推动着各行各业的变革。然而,随着AI技术的广泛应用,人们逐渐发现,仅仅拥有强大的AI模型并不足以满足实际需求。如何将这些模型有效地部署到生产环境中,如何持续监控和优化模型性能,以及如何确保模型的安全性和稳定性,成为了摆在我们面前的重大挑战。为了应对这些挑战,MLOps(机器学习运营)应运而生。
MLOps是一组将机器学习模型从开发到生产的过程进行工程化的技术和方法。它的目标是提高模型的可靠性、可维护性和可扩展性,从而确保AI技术能够在生产环境中稳定运行,为企业带来实际的商业价值。
一、MLOps的实践方法
二、MLOps的挑战与未来发展
虽然MLOps带来了许多好处,但在实际应用中,我们也面临着一些挑战。首先,MLOps需要跨学科的知识和技能,涉及机器学习、软件开发、运维等多个领域。因此,如何培养一支具备这些知识和技能的团队,是MLOps面临的一个重要挑战。其次,随着模型规模的扩大和复杂度的增加,如何保证模型的性能和稳定性,也是一个亟待解决的问题。最后,随着数据安全和隐私保护越来越受到重视,如何在保障数据安全的前提下进行模型训练和优化,也是MLOps需要关注的一个方面。
展望未来,MLOps将继续发展并与其他技术相结合,形成更加完善和强大的AI工程化体系。例如,MLOps可以与DevOps相结合,形成MLOps+DevOps的模式,进一步提高AI技术的研发效率和生产质量。此外,随着边缘计算和物联网等技术的发展,MLOps也将向边缘端延伸,为边缘智能提供支持。
总之,MLOps作为人工智能工程化的关键一环,对于推动AI技术的广泛应用和商业化具有重要意义。通过不断探索和实践MLOps的最佳实践方法和技术手段,我们可以为AI技术的发展注入新的活力,为企业带来更大的商业价值。